Off the Beaten Track was a British travel documentary show that aired on ITV from 1 November to 13 December 2013 and was presented by Christine Bleakley.

In the series, a rival to the BBC's Countryfile,[1] Bleakley "discovered Britain's hidden gems", by travelling to places that are not generally considered tourist attractions. It was reported that she was inspired by "her love of Britain and a childhood spent holidaying at home". She said of the series: "When we first discussed ideas for the series, I happened to mention that I had never had a foreign holiday until I was 18. I always holidayed at home and we travelled the length and breadth of Ireland and Scotland. I have a real appreciation of what is around us and this series is reminding people what a beautiful part of the world we live in. I loved every minute filming the show as it really was such a lovely, happy time."[2]

Bleakley said she would "love" to make a second series,[2] but in March 2014, it was announced that a second series would not be commissioned, said to be because of low ratings.[1] A source for the show said, "It simply wasn't as strong as similar rival shows, and there's no chance of it returning."[3][4]
